What is Coloring Therapy?

Coloring therapy, also known as art therapy, leverages the creative process of coloring to promote relaxation, focus, and emotional regulation. The repetitive motions involved in coloring can have a meditative effect, calming the mind and reducing anxiety. The act of choosing colors and filling spaces allows for self-expression and a sense of accomplishment, boosting self-esteem and promoting a sense of calm.

How Does Coloring Help with Emotional Well-being?

The benefits of coloring for emotional well-being are multifaceted:

  • Stress Reduction: The repetitive nature of coloring can act as a form of meditation, quieting racing thoughts and lowering cortisol levels (the stress hormone).
  • Mindfulness: Coloring encourages focus on the present moment, promoting mindfulness and reducing overthinking.
  • Emotional Expression: Choosing colors and patterns can be a subtle way to express emotions that might be difficult to articulate verbally.
  • Self-Esteem Boost: Completing a coloring page provides a sense of accomplishment and boosts self-esteem, particularly for those struggling with self-doubt.
  • Improved Focus and Concentration: Coloring requires concentration, which can help improve focus and attention span.

How can I use inspirational quotes in my coloring therapy sessions?

You can incorporate inspirational quotes into your coloring therapy sessions in several ways:

  • Print and display: Print your favorite quotes and place them near your coloring area as a visual reminder.
  • Write them in: Write or lightly trace inspirational quotes directly onto your coloring page before you start.
  • Create a coloring book: Design your own coloring book incorporating inspiring quotes throughout.
  • Meditate on the quotes: Take time before or after coloring to reflect on the meaning of the quotes.

Are there any specific types of coloring pages that are better suited for this type of therapy?

While any coloring page can be used, mandalas and nature-themed designs are often favored due to their intricate patterns and calming imagery. These designs lend themselves well to meditative coloring and can enhance the overall therapeutic experience.
